-Ready for pressure of spotlight, ready to prove he's a legit # 2 receiver for the panthers by making plays

-I get to the next level by making plays on consistent level and have everyone in NFL talking about me, same way Smitty did it( on being a household name outside the carolinas)

-I'm a little more physical than Smitty, not taking anything away from him he's very physical too, better blocker, better ball catcher over the middle than Smitty, Smiths a better deep threat(on how's different than Smitty)

-Last year training was all on me, but this year have OTA'S, been able to get into my playbook and ask Smitty a bunch of questions about how do I better my game,etc.(on how he's preparing for the season)

Being around Smitty day in and day out and other guys around the league helped out so far

-Feel like we have enough receivers on the field already that have built chemistry together, we were top 5 in passing last year, we feel like we can get the job done(on if he agrees with Smith about needing Plax)

-Agrees that everyone is tighter this year, got to do everything together this year.Last year we only had 2 weeks together to build chemistry, this year much different, even went a played paint ball together. Know the playbook, learn more than just 1 receiver position.(on building team chemistry)

-We all were was second guessing the pick of Luke,at then end of the day he's here now but he's looked good in OTA'S so far, he's here to win and were glad to have him on the team, he can do it all inside backer, outside backer, special teams, he's got time to win everyone over just like Cam did, last year people were also second guessing Cam. (on If Luke was the right pick)

-Win division, get into playoffs(personal goals)

Thinks if we can get into the playoffs we can make a run

-I knew Cam was a baller in first game against AZ, called first TD before it happened.
